1. Hallmarks

Hallmarks, a collection of official symbols stamped onto silver objects, represent a essential aspect in figuring out and authenticating these things. Particularly, with this kind of diminutive vessel, hallmarks function a definitive marker of origin, silver purity, and date of manufacture. The presence of clear, legible hallmarks on a diminutive vessel offers quick proof of its legitimacy as a real instance of vintage silverware. For example, a silver merchandise from Birmingham, England, will bear a particular anchor mark, indicating its assay workplace. This mark, along with a date letter and maker’s mark, establishes the piece’s provenance and age. With out verifiable hallmarks, the attribution and worth of the silver merchandise are considerably compromised.

The meticulous research of hallmarks is a sensible talent for collectors and sellers alike. Figuring out the maker’s mark, usually a singular mixture of initials or a particular image, permits for tracing the vessel again to its authentic silversmith or manufacturing firm. Information of date letter programs additional refines the relationship course of, enabling a exact evaluation of the piece’s historic context. The lion passant, denoting sterling silver (.925 purity), and different purity marks guarantee patrons of the silver content material and materials worth of the piece. Incorrect or lacking hallmarks increase purple flags, suggesting potential reproductions or alterations.

In conclusion, hallmarks aren’t merely ornamental additions to an merchandise; they’re important instruments for verification and valuation. An intensive understanding of hallmark programs protects towards fraud and ensures that the worth of the article aligns with its historic and materials value. The absence of discernible or verifiable hallmarks presents a major problem to establishing authenticity, underscoring their elementary significance in assessing silver objects.

2. Silver Purity

The silver purity of an vintage silver bud vase straight impacts its valuation, aesthetic qualities, and long-term preservation. Understanding the composition of the metallic is essential for each collectors and historians in figuring out authenticity and general value.

  • Sterling Silver (.925)

    Sterling silver, denoted by a purity of .925 or 92.5% pure silver, is a standard commonplace for high-quality silverware. The remaining 7.5% is often copper, added to extend the alloy’s hardness and sturdiness. A diminutive vessel marked as sterling is usually thought-about extra useful than these of decrease silver content material. The presence of a sterling hallmark gives assurance of a standardized stage of silver content material.

  • Coin Silver (.900)

    Coin silver, usually present in earlier items, possesses a purity of roughly .900 or 90% pure silver. This commonplace arose from the apply of melting down silver cash to create silverware. Whereas nonetheless useful, objects constructed from coin silver could also be thought-about barely much less fascinating than sterling items because of the decrease silver content material and doubtlessly much less refined alloy. This variation is crucial to acknowledge when evaluating pre-Victorian period items.

  • Silverplate

    Silverplate refers to a base metallic, equivalent to copper or brass, coated with a skinny layer of silver. Whereas silverplated objects can mimic the looks of stable silver, they’re considerably much less useful as a result of the silver layer can put on away over time, exposing the bottom metallic. Figuring out silverplate usually includes on the lookout for telltale indicators of damage or base metallic publicity, and understanding that it’ll lack the intrinsic bullion worth of stable silver.

  • Continental Silver (Numerous Purities)

    Continental silver, originating from European nations, displays a spread of purity requirements. Frequent purities embrace .800, .830, and .935. The presence of particular hallmarks indicating the silver content material is important for figuring out the origin and worth of the piece. Variations in silver purity amongst Continental silver require cautious examination of hallmarks and assay marks to determine the exact silver content material.

The silver purity of such a vessel not solely determines its materials worth but in addition impacts its resistance to tarnish and its suitability for sprucing. Larger purity silver, like sterling, sometimes maintains its luster longer and responds properly to light cleansing strategies. Recognizing the variations in silver purity permits for correct valuation and acceptable preservation methods, guaranteeing that the historic and aesthetic worth of every merchandise is maintained. The evaluation of a bit, subsequently, includes contemplating not solely its design and provenance but in addition a cautious analysis of its silver content material.

3. Design Interval

The design interval of an vintage silver bud vase considerably influences its aesthetic character, worth, and historic context. The prevailing creative actions and stylistic preferences of a particular period straight formed the shape, ornamentation, and craftsmanship evident in these diminutive vessels, making design interval a vital determinant of their identification and appreciation.

  • Victorian Period (1837-1901)

    Victorian design, characterised by elaborate ornamentation, naturalistic motifs, and nostalgic symbolism, discovered expression in silver bud vases by means of intricate floral engravings, repouss work, and using gems. Examples embrace vases adorned with roses, lilies, or ivy, reflecting the Victorian fascination with floral language. The opulence and element typical of this era are indicative of the period’s emphasis on show and refinement.

  • Artwork Nouveau (1890-1910)

    Artwork Nouveau design embraced flowing strains, natural types, and a rejection of business standardization. Silver bud vases from this era usually function sinuous curves, stylized floral motifs, and asymmetrical designs. The affect of nature is obvious in items depicting irises, water lilies, or dragonfly wings, executed with a concentrate on fluidity and motion. The emphasis on handcrafted high quality additional defines this era.

  • Artwork Deco (1920-1939)

    Artwork Deco design celebrated geometric shapes, streamlined types, and a way of modernity. Silver bud vases of this period show clear strains, stepped patterns, and geometric motifs equivalent to chevrons, zigzags, and sunbursts. Supplies like enamel, ivory, and onyx had been usually integrated to boost the vases’ visible attraction. The general aesthetic displays the Artwork Deco motion’s emphasis on luxurious, sophistication, and machine-age aesthetics.

  • Mid-Century Fashionable (1945-1969)

    Mid-Century Fashionable design centered on simplicity, performance, and clear strains. Silver bud vases from this era are characterised by minimalist types, unadorned surfaces, and a concentrate on practicality. The emphasis was on creating objects that had been each aesthetically pleasing and useful, reflecting the period’s embrace of recent know-how and streamlined design rules. The absence of elaborate ornamentation is a trademark of this model.

By understanding the design traits related to every interval, collectors and fans can extra precisely establish, date, and recognize these things. The stylistic components current in an vintage silver bud vase provide useful insights into the creative and cultural influences that formed its creation, additional enhancing its historic and aesthetic significance.

7. Patina

Patina, the floor layer acquired by means of age and publicity, profoundly influences the aesthetic worth and historic authenticity of vintage silver bud vases. This alteration of the floor, ensuing from oxidation and environmental components, is a key indicator of age and contributes to the article’s general character. An understanding of patina is subsequently important for collectors and historians in evaluating these things.

  • Formation and Composition

    Patina on silver is primarily composed of silver sulfide, a dark-colored compound fashioned by the response of silver with sulfur-containing compounds within the ambiance. The method is gradual, occurring over many years and even centuries. The composition and price of formation are influenced by environmental components equivalent to humidity, temperature, and the presence of pollution. A vase saved in a damp atmosphere, for instance, might develop a darker and extra pronounced patina in comparison with one saved in a dry local weather. The character of this formation serves as a testomony to age and publicity.

  • Aesthetic Affect

    The aesthetic influence of patina is subjective however usually extremely valued. Many collectors prize the mushy, heat look of aged silver, contemplating it extra interesting than the brilliant, reflective floor of newly polished silver. Patina can intensify the main points of the design, highlighting the intricate patterns and craftsmanship of the piece. A well-developed patina lends an air of authenticity and historic depth, enhancing the visible attraction of the vintage silver bud vase. The perceived fantastic thing about patina contributes considerably to its market worth.

  • Preservation Issues

    The preservation of patina is a essential consideration for collectors and curators. Whereas a point of tarnish is usually accepted and even desired, extreme tarnish can obscure the main points of the design and doubtlessly injury the underlying silver. Aggressive sprucing can take away the patina completely, diminishing the article’s worth and historic integrity. Light cleansing strategies, utilizing specialised silver polishes designed to take away solely the floor tarnish, are really helpful to protect the patina whereas sustaining the silver’s look. A cautious stability between cleansing and preservation is crucial.

  • Authenticity and Valuation

    Patina can function an indicator of authenticity, serving to to differentiate real antiques from fashionable reproductions. A constant, even patina that conforms to the floor contours of the article is troublesome to duplicate artificially. The presence of such patina helps the declare of age and authenticity. In distinction, uneven or artificially induced patina might increase suspicions of forgery. The character of the patina, subsequently, contributes to the general valuation of the vintage silver bud vase.

The nuances of patina, from its chemical composition to its aesthetic and historic implications, underscore its significance within the analysis and appreciation of those particular silver objects. Its presence connects the bodily artifact to the passage of time, making its cautious consideration essential for these searching for to grasp and protect these items.

Preservation and Care Suggestions for Vintage Silver Bud Vases

The longevity and aesthetic attraction of a bit are contingent upon correct care and upkeep. The next pointers provide essential insights into guaranteeing the preservation of worth of an vintage silver bud vase.

Tip 1: Implement Cautious Dealing with Practices: All the time deal with with clear, dry arms to stop the switch of oils and acids. Keep away from gripping the vase too tightly, which might trigger dents or distortions. Assist the bottom whereas lifting or transferring to stop unintentional drops.

Tip 2: Make use of Light Cleansing Methods: Use a mushy, lint-free material particularly designed for sprucing silver. Apply a minimal quantity of specialised silver polish, working in straight strains to keep away from swirl marks. Rinse completely with distilled water and dry instantly to stop water spots.

Tip 3: Management Environmental Situations: Retailer in a cool, dry atmosphere away from direct daylight and excessive temperature fluctuations. Excessive humidity can speed up tarnishing. Think about using a desiccant to soak up moisture in storage areas.

Tip 4: Reduce Publicity to Corrosive Substances: Keep away from contact with cleansing brokers, perfumes, or different chemical compounds that may injury the silver floor. These substances could cause irreversible corrosion and discoloration. Deal with with care to keep away from extended publicity.

Tip 5: Think about Skilled Conservation: For useful or closely tarnished items, seek the advice of an expert silver conservator. They possess the experience and specialised instruments to soundly clear, restore, and protect vintage silver with out inflicting injury.

Tip 6: Protecting Storage is really helpful: When not in use, retailer in a tarnish-resistant material bag or inside a lined silver chest. These supplies assist to reduce publicity to air and moisture, slowing the tarnishing course of and sustaining the vase’s luster.

Adherence to those preservation and care practices ensures the worth and longevity of these things are preserved for generations. Constant, conscientious care preserves aesthetic attraction.
